Toybox v0.8.7 was discovered to contain a NULL pointer dereference via the component httpd.c. This vulnerability can lead to a Denial of Service (DoS) via unspecified vectors.
A NULL pointer dereference occurs when the application dereferences a pointer that it expects to be valid, but is NULL, typically causing a crash or exit.
